Understanding the Benefits of Selling Your Home for Cash

Selling your home for cash offers a range of benefits that can make the selling process faster and more convenient. One significant advantage is the speed of the transaction. Unlike traditional home sales that can take months, selling your home for cash typically involves shorter timeframes. Cash buyers are often ready to close the deal quickly, eliminating the need for lengthy negotiations or waiting for financing approvals. This can be especially helpful when you need to sell your home urgently, such as in situations involving relocation or financial constraints.

Another advantage of selling for cash is the convenience it provides. Cash buyers are usually real estate investors or companies that specialize in purchasing properties quickly and hassle-free. Because they buy homes in their current condition, you can avoid the expenses and time associated with repairs, renovations, and staging. This can save you not only money but also the stress and inconvenience of preparing your home for sale. Additionally, selling for cash bypasses the need for real estate agents and their commissions, allowing you to keep more of your proceeds from the sale.

Tips for Researching and Identifying Reputable Cash Home Buyers

When it comes to selling your home for cash, it's essential to do your due diligence in researching and identifying reputable cash home buyers in your local market. Here are some tips to help you make informed decisions:

First, start by conducting thorough online research. Look for reputable real estate companies or investors in your area who specialize in buying homes for cash. Check their websites, read customer reviews, and look for any accreditation or certifications that may vouch for their credibility.

Additionally, consider reaching out to your local real estate agent or trusted friends and family for recommendations. They may have firsthand experience or know someone who has successfully sold their home for cash. Don't hesitate to ask for referrals and gather as much information as possible before making a decision.

Remember to always verify the credentials and legitimacy of cash home buyers before entering into any agreements or providing sensitive information. This can include checking for a valid business license, understanding their buying process, and ensuring they have a physical office or contact address. Taking these steps will help protect you from potential scams and ensure a smooth transaction when selling your home for cash.

Avoiding Common Pitfalls and Scams When Selling for Cash

Selling your home for cash can be a convenient and fast way to get rid of a property. However, it's important to be cautious and avoid common pitfalls and scams that can potentially leave you in a vulnerable position. One of the most significant risks when selling for cash is dealing with unscrupulous buyers who may try to take advantage of your urgency or lack of experience in the real estate market.

To ensure a smooth and safe transaction, it's crucial to thoroughly research and vet potential cash home buyers. Look for reputable companies or individuals with positive reviews and a proven track record. Avoid working with buyers who pressure you into making hasty decisions or request large upfront fees before the sale is finalized. Additionally, be cautious of buyers who offer significantly less than your home's market value or attempt to negotiate unfair terms. By doing your due diligence and staying vigilant, you can protect yourself and your investment from potential scams and pitfalls when selling your home for cash.

The Importance of Proper Documentation and Legalities in Cash Home Sales

Proper documentation and adhering to legalities are of utmost importance when selling your home for cash. These factors play a crucial role in protecting both the buyer and the seller, ensuring a smooth and hassle-free transaction. By carefully preparing all the necessary paperwork, you can build trust, instill confidence, and avoid potential disputes or complications that may arise.

One vital document in cash home sales is the purchase agreement. This legally binding contract outlines the terms and conditions of the sale, including the agreed-upon price, deposit amount, and any contingencies. It is essential to include all pertinent details in the agreement to protect both parties' interests and clearly define their rights and responsibilities. Additionally, the property title and deed must be correctly transferred to the buyer to establish their ownership legally. This transfer requires specific legal procedures, such as a title search and the execution of a deed, to ensure that the property is free of any liens or encumbrances. Adhering to these legalities not only provides peace of mind but also safeguards your investment in the long run.
